Job Description

As a Substance Use Disorder (SUD) clinician, you will work in an outpatient setting with an average caseload of 12 clients.

Client Care & Treatment
  • Develop personalized biopsychosocial treatment plans for new clients.
  • Provide SUD and mental health assessments, counseling, and intervention services.
  • Conduct individual, group, and family therapy sessions.
  • Develop service plans and conduct reviews throughout treatment.
Coordination & Collaboration
  • Work closely with clinical and administrative staff to ensure high‑quality care.
  • Coordinate with medical and psychiatric providers for comprehensive care.
  • Ensure smooth discharge planning and follow‑ups.
Compliance & Documentation
  • Maintain thorough documentation according to federal and state guidelines.
  • Participate in annual cultural competency, diversity, and safety training.
Community Engagement
  • Represent Wis Hope at community events, trainings, and meetings.
  • Build and maintain positive relationships with referral sources and partners.
Qualifications
  • Master’s degree in Social Work, Counseling, Psychology, or related field.
  • Licensure (SAC-IT, SAC-SCAC) or working toward licensure preferred.
  • Experience in addiction treatment and mental health care.
  • Strong interpersonal, communication, and organizational skills.
  • Commitment to cultural competency and diversity in care.
